Doctor: kidney is the same as a filter, which filtrates the blood flowing through it continuously and eliminates various metabolic waste and excessive moisture at the same time. If Renal Failure occurs, most renal function will be lost. Urine insufficiency leads to the gathering of metabolin, thus appearing Terminal Renal Failure or Uremia. Actually, Terminal Renal Failure (also Terminal Kidney Failure) or Uremia is a series of clinical reactions caused by the gathering of toxin after renal function has been damaged.
